• Home
  • Raw
  • Download

Lines Matching refs:pdev

90   struct hwc_composer_device_data_t* pdev =  in hwc_vsync_thread()  local
94 int64_t base_timestamp = pdev->vsync_base_timestamp; in hwc_vsync_thread()
110 timestamp += pdev->vsync_period_ns - in hwc_vsync_thread()
111 (timestamp - base_timestamp) % pdev->vsync_period_ns; in hwc_vsync_thread()
126 if (pdev && pdev->procs) { in hwc_vsync_thread()
127 vsync_proc = pdev->procs->vsync; in hwc_vsync_thread()
133 vsync_proc(const_cast<hwc_procs_t*>(pdev->procs), 0, timestamp); in hwc_vsync_thread()
393 struct cvd_hwc_composer_device_1_t* pdev = in cvd_hwc_register_procs() local
395 pdev->vsync_data.procs = procs; in cvd_hwc_register_procs()
407 struct cvd_hwc_composer_device_1_t* pdev = in cvd_hwc_query() local
416 value[0] = pdev->vsync_data.vsync_period_ns; in cvd_hwc_query()
457 static int32_t cvd_hwc_attribute(struct cvd_hwc_composer_device_1_t* pdev, in cvd_hwc_attribute() argument
461 return pdev->vsync_data.vsync_period_ns; in cvd_hwc_attribute()
463 return pdev->composer->x_res(); in cvd_hwc_attribute()
465 return pdev->composer->y_res(); in cvd_hwc_attribute()
467 ALOGI("Reporting DPI_X of %d", pdev->composer->dpi()); in cvd_hwc_attribute()
469 return pdev->composer->dpi() * 1000; in cvd_hwc_attribute()
471 ALOGI("Reporting DPI_Y of %d", pdev->composer->dpi()); in cvd_hwc_attribute()
473 return pdev->composer->dpi() * 1000; in cvd_hwc_attribute()
484 struct cvd_hwc_composer_device_1_t* pdev = in cvd_hwc_get_display_attributes() local
492 values[i] = cvd_hwc_attribute(pdev, attributes[i]); in cvd_hwc_get_display_attributes()